Staff was very attentive however, the food was subpar. Being told that the food was premade and not made to order would have Gordon Ramsey cuss the owner out for cheaping out like that. My wife felt ill after eating there due to that. You talk about your pride at the restaurant, but if that were true you'd actually serve fresh made to order food that didn't taste bland and generic. I don't know if we caught yall on a bad day, your standards dropped, or what else may have changed but our experience was not like these 5 stars I'm seeing. I feel sorry for your staff that they have to lie to customers about the freshness of food in order to keep customers, thankfully you have one honest server, who told us when we were ordering and wanted leave stuff off the food, that the food was premade. Wife chose this place because she had heard good things about it, but i guess all those positive things are in the past because we didn't experience anything like these 5 stars did. The restaurant wasn't even busy and the wait times weren't bad, but frankly i felt scammed getting a $40 bill for food that added together didn't come close to the bill. All we got were the nachos as an appetizer, which presentation wise threw me off because they looked burnt and they tasted stale, the slam burger which definitely tasted frozen, and the chimichanga which, according to my wife was disappointing, much like...

This place ticks all the boxes
 Chef driven kitchen. They have thought about the details, and all the flavors compliment each other. I’ve never asked for a modification, except for more jalapeños with my chips and salsa, but the kitchen staff seems more than capable of handling changes. Really though, trust the kitchen, you won’t be disappointed. The bartender’s are top notch, while I tend to have a set drink preference here, I had an amazing martini a couple of nights ago. It wasn’t served in a martini glass, but I ain’t that picky. It was quite tasty. They are also knowledgeable about the food so don’t hesitate to ask. The servers are friendly, knowledgeable as well, and know the menu too. Don’t be afraid to ask them what they like to eat, and don’t be afraid to follow their lead. Price wise this a very reasonable place to go. It seems to me that they have hit upon the “we are making money, but not overcharging customers” price point. All said, great food, killer drinks, won’t break your budget, and you’ll probably have a damn good time. Try the Brussel Sprouts, ‘cause your mama said eat more...

My husband and I couldn't wait for the new Boiling Springs location to open up, as we have never been to a Willy Taco. First visit was with family, and we were very happy about our decision. The food was great and the service was good. I'm a real salsa and chips kinda gal and let me tell you this salsa is so fresh and to die for they even have blue corn chips which is a plus. Our next two visits also went well. Our 4th visit not so much, but things happen and that's called life. After a private message to management they made things right. I can say the management and team member there really care. We decided to give it another go tonight and I can honestly say that we were very pleased. Management went out of their way to make sure we were happy, and that showed they truly cared. The food is scrumptious and we were very happy about giving it another go. The Taco salad, burrito bowl and quesidellas are absolutely amazing. Our server Ashton was totally awesome. Thank you Willy Taco for being an amazing establishment in...

From my personal experience DO NOT go to the Willy Taco in Spartanburg. My partner and I walked in around 9pm if I'm not mistaken on the time. (Regardless it was night and past rush hours.) We stood at the host's desk whilst about four employees stared at us before they continued talking. A young woman walked from the tables asked if we had been spoken with, we said no. She turned to a lady I assume was the host and said "there are people waiting." This hostess looks us dead in the face and turns around and walks off. Mind you they weren't busy and that's saying something for the Willy Taco in Spartanburg. We left and came to the Willy Taco here in Boiling Springs. So with that being said Willy Taco Boiling Springs? Amazing! We walked in and immediately were greeted and seated. The young gentleman who was our waiter that night went above and beyond and he was phenomenally sweet! If I want Willy Taco I will always choose the one in Boiling Springs. It's closer anyways.

3 stars seems a bit harsh, but half of my experience here was wonderful, and the other half could only be described as average, which isn't necessarily bad. I ordered the four for twenty special, ordering the street corn fritters, cheeseburger taco, mother clucker, and the dessert option as well. The picture is unrelated, and from another party member, but pictured is the Seoul city taco and the fish and chips taco. The street corn fritters were the highlight of the entire meal, and we're delicious. Me and my party enjoyed them greatly. The cheeseburger taco was probably the best one we had ordered as well, the mother clucker and Seoul tacos were average, and the fish and chips taco felt lacking. The dessert was lackluster and very small, I expected to be able to share with my party but the dessert really only seemed to be for one person. I would go again, but be cautious of the price.

First time here and wow!!! I've always heard mixed reviews and so I haven't gone, but man have I been missing out. I was very impressed. Great service, seasoning/sauces, and OMG the drinks!!! It's hard finding vegetarian options that don't taste bland, but this fit the bill. The roasted cauliflower side was out of this world on flavor profile and my avocado taco was simple but delicious. Also, the sangria was the best I've ever had, not sickly sweet like most and actually tasted more like the ingredients than other restaurants. My husband has the Argentinan quesadilla that he's still going on and on about. His super margarita was amazing and didn't taste like straight sour mix. Definitely new favorite easy go-to when you don't know what to eat!!!!!!!!
